The Minister of Foreign Affairs and Cooperation, Maria Manuela dos Santos Lucas, reiterated Mozambique’s commitment to continue advancing the implementation process of the African Continental Free Trade Area (AfCFTA).
Speaking at the 47th Executive Council Meeting of the African Union (AU), in which she has been participating since Thursday in Malabo, the capital of Equatorial Guinea, Maria Manuela dos Santos Lucas assured that all conditions are being created for the implementation of the AfCFTA, with the aim of promoting intra-regional and intra-continental trade.
She congratulated the AfCFTA Secretariat for the excellent work carried out, which is reflected in the increasing number of countries joining the initiative.
During this event, the minister witnessed the election of the Commissioner for Economic Development, Trade, Tourism, Industry and Minerals, Francisca T. Balope from Equatorial Guinea; the Commissioner for Education, Science, Technology and Innovation of the African Union, Gaspard Banyankibona from Burundi; and five members of the AU Advisory Council against Corruption.
